The Rise of Artificial Intelligence
Artificial Intelligence (AI) is at the forefront of technological innovation. AI systems are becoming increasingly sophisticated, capable of performing tasks that were once thought to be exclusively human. In healthcare, AI is being used to diagnose diseases with remarkable accuracy, while in finance, it is revolutionizing fraud detection and risk management. The integration of AI into everyday life is set to accelerate, with predictions suggesting that by 2026, AI will be ubiquitous in both personal and professional settings.
Sustainable Energy Solutions
As concerns about climate change grow, the demand for sustainable energy solutions is on the rise. Renewable energy sources such as solar, wind, and hydroelectric power are becoming more efficient and cost-effective. Governments and private sectors are investing heavily in research and development to harness these resources. The transition to a green economy is not only environmentally beneficial but also economically viable. By 2026, it is anticipated that a significant portion of the world’s energy will be derived from renewable sources, marking a pivotal shift in global energy consumption patterns.
Advancements in Biotechnology
Biotechnology is another field that is poised for significant growth. Breakthroughs in genetic engineering and biopharmaceuticals are paving the way for personalized medicine. Scientists are now able to tailor treatments to individual genetic profiles, leading to more effective and targeted therapies. The ethical implications of these advancements are also being closely examined, as the potential for misuse raises important questions about the boundaries of scientific exploration.
The Impact of the Internet of Things (IoT)
The Internet of Things (IoT) is transforming the way we interact with our environment. Smart devices are becoming increasingly prevalent, from smart homes to smart cities. These devices collect and analyze data to improve efficiency and convenience. However, the proliferation of IoT also brings challenges, particularly in terms of data security and privacy. As we move towards a more interconnected world, it is crucial to address these issues to ensure the safe and responsible use of IoT technology.
Education and the Digital Age
The education sector is undergoing a digital revolution. Online learning platforms and virtual classrooms are making education more accessible to a global audience. The COVID-19 pandemic has accelerated this trend, with many institutions adopting remote learning models. By 2026, it is expected that digital education will be the norm, with traditional classrooms supplemented by virtual learning environments. This shift has the potential to bridge educational gaps and provide opportunities for lifelong learning.
